The beginning of the 21st century can be characterized as the” time-delay boom” leading to numerous important results. This book is based on the course ”Introduction to time-delay systems” for graduate students in Engineering and Applied Mathematics that the author taught in Tel Aviv University in 2011-2012 and 2012-2013 academic years.
"This book is devoted to analysis of time delay systems and control design for such systems. ... The book provides numerous examples, exercises and a detailed list of references. It is readable enough and can be useful to engineers and mathematicians, as well as to graduate students." (Valery Y. Glizer, Mathematical Reviews, April, 2015)
